- The distance between Arbaat, Sudan and Ovruc, Ukraine is approximately 3,573 km or 2,220 mi.
- To reach Arbaat in this distance one would set out from Ovruc bearing 165.4° or SSE and follow the great circles arc to approach Arbaat bearing 170.4° or S .
- Arbaat has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as Ovruc has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Arbaat is in or near the subtropical desert biome whereas Ovruc is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 22.5 °C (40.5°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 11.5 °C (20.7°F) less in Arbaat.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 605.4 mm (23.8 in) less which is equivalent to 605.4 l/m² (14.86 US gal/ft²) or 6,054,000 l/ha (647,213 US gal/ac) less. About 0 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 30.5° higher in Arbaat than in Ovruc.
